Job Title: Senior Mechanical Engineer

Location: Houston, TX (1 position, Long Term)

Location: Carrollton, TX (1 position, 6-12 months)

Type:        Contract

Experience: 8–20 Years

 

 

What You will Do:

  • Support the execution of new product development projects. Responsibilities include:
  • Developing new design, 3D models of prototype components, assemblies, and test fixtures using SolidWorks
  • Performing engineering design calculations
  • Authoring and executing product validation test procedures
  • Documenting results through formal test reports
  • Creating design calculators to support engineering analysis


What You Will Bring:

  • Proficiency in SolidWorks or equivalent CAD software
  • Strong command of Microsoft Office Suite
  • Experience with all design engineering calculation (preferred but not required)
  • Background in electro-mechanical systems (preferred)
  • Hands-on experience with product development testing (preferred)
  • Ability to work semi-autonomously with minimal supervision
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
